Director,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ency (CISA)Jen Easterly is the Director, of CISA: America's Cyber Defense Agency. Before, she worked as Head of Firm Resilience and the Fusion Resilience Center at Morgan Stanley, Special Assistant to the President and Senior Director for Counterterrorism at National Security Council, The White House, Deputy Director for Counterterrorism at National Security Agency, U.S. Cyber Command Implementation Team at United States Cyber Command.
